WASHINGTON — Rep. Alexandria Ocasio-Cortez on Sunday called for increased transparency and potential cuts to federal funding for Elon Musk’s defense and space contracts, arguing that government spending on such projects should face greater scrutiny.

“If you want to start with waste, start with Elon’s defense contracts at the Pentagon,” Ocasio-Cortez wrote on X, formerly Twitter. “In fact, we should start with transparency around defense contracts in general, which take up an enormous sum of public funds.”

The congresswoman’s comments come as SpaceX, Musk’s aerospace company, continues to secure lucrative contracts with the Pentagon and NASA. The company has played a key role in U.S. space exploration and national security, including launching military satellites and working on classified defense projects.

Ocasio-Cortez has frequently criticized government spending on defense and military initiatives, advocating instead for reallocating funds to domestic programs. Her latest remarks align with broader Democratic efforts to reassess military expenditures, though no formal legislation has been introduced to target SpaceX’s funding.

Her call to cut funding on America’s space program is not likely to gain any traction in Congress.
